So, you're diving into the fascinating world of quantitative finance? Awesome! Quant finance, at its core, is all about using mathematical and statistical methods to tackle financial problems. Whether you're aiming to build sophisticated trading algorithms, manage risk with precision, or price complex derivatives, having a solid foundation is absolutely crucial. That's where books come in! But with so many options out there, finding the right ones can feel like searching for a needle in a haystack. That's why we're turning to the collective wisdom of Reddit, a treasure trove of insights and recommendations from fellow quants, aspiring quants, and finance enthusiasts. Let's explore some of the best quant finance books Reddit has to offer, covering everything from foundational concepts to advanced techniques. Knowing what to read can be a total game-changer, setting you on the path to mastering this exciting and challenging field. Getting started can be daunting, but with the right resources and a bit of dedication, you'll be well on your way to becoming a successful quant. Dive into these recommendations, and prepare to level up your quant skills!

    Essential Foundations: Building Your Quant Base

    Before you start building complex models and algorithms, it's essential to have a firm grasp of the fundamentals. This section covers the core areas that every aspiring quant needs to master. Think of these books as the building blocks of your quant knowledge – without them, your understanding might crumble under pressure. Let's break down the must-read books that cover mathematics, statistics, probability, and introductory finance.

    Mathematics for Quant Finance

    Mathematics is the bedrock of quantitative finance. Without a solid understanding of mathematical concepts, you'll struggle to grasp the intricacies of financial models and algorithms. One book that consistently receives high praise is "Mathematics for Machine Learning" by Marc Peter Deisenroth, A. Aldo Faisal, and Cheng Soon Ong. Although it's geared toward machine learning, the mathematical foundations it covers are directly applicable to quant finance. You'll find comprehensive explanations of linear algebra, calculus, probability, and optimization—all essential tools for any aspiring quant. The book's clear explanations and practical examples make it accessible even if you don't have a strong mathematical background. Additionally, "Linear Algebra and Its Applications" by Gilbert Strang is an excellent resource for mastering linear algebra, a critical area for understanding portfolio optimization and risk management. Strang's engaging writing style and focus on practical applications make this book a favorite among students and professionals alike. Finally, for a more advanced treatment, consider "Real and Complex Analysis" by Walter Rudin. While challenging, this book provides a rigorous foundation in analysis that will serve you well in advanced quantitative finance topics. Mastering these mathematical concepts will empower you to tackle complex problems with confidence and precision. Remember, a strong mathematical foundation is the key to unlocking the full potential of quantitative finance.

    Statistics and Probability

    Statistics and probability are just as vital as mathematics in the quant world. These disciplines provide the tools to analyze data, build predictive models, and assess risk. A highly recommended book in this area is "All of Statistics: A Concise Course in Statistical Inference" by Larry Wasserman. This book offers a comprehensive overview of statistical inference, covering topics such as estimation, hypothesis testing, and regression. Its concise yet thorough approach makes it an excellent choice for those looking to quickly grasp the essentials of statistics. Another popular choice is "Introduction to Probability" by Joseph K. Blitzstein and Jessica Hwang. This book provides a clear and intuitive introduction to probability theory, with plenty of examples and exercises to reinforce your understanding. Its emphasis on real-world applications makes it particularly relevant for quant finance. For a more advanced treatment of probability, consider "Probability and Random Processes" by Geoffrey Grimmett and David Stirzaker. This book delves into the more theoretical aspects of probability, providing a solid foundation for understanding stochastic processes and other advanced topics. With a strong understanding of statistics and probability, you'll be well-equipped to analyze financial data, build robust models, and make informed decisions. Remember, these skills are essential for success in the dynamic world of quantitative finance.

    Introductory Finance

    While you don't need to be a finance expert to become a quant, having a solid understanding of introductory finance concepts is essential. You need to know how markets work, what financial instruments exist, and how they're valued. A great starting point is "Options, Futures, and Other Derivatives" by John Hull. This book is widely regarded as the bible of derivatives pricing and provides a comprehensive introduction to options, futures, and other derivative instruments. It covers everything from basic pricing models to more advanced topics like exotic options and credit derivatives. Another excellent resource is "Investments" by Bodie, Kane, and Marcus. This book provides a broad overview of the investment landscape, covering topics such as portfolio management, asset pricing, and market efficiency. Its clear and engaging writing style makes it accessible to readers with little or no prior finance knowledge. For a more quantitative approach, consider "Financial Markets and Corporate Strategy" by Grinblatt and Titman. This book bridges the gap between finance theory and practice, providing a rigorous treatment of financial decision-making. With a solid foundation in introductory finance, you'll be able to understand the context in which quantitative models are used and make more informed decisions. Remember, finance knowledge is the bridge that connects your quantitative skills to the real world.

    Advanced Techniques: Leveling Up Your Quant Skills

    Once you've mastered the fundamentals, it's time to delve into more advanced techniques. This section covers books that focus on specific areas of quant finance, such as time series analysis, stochastic calculus, and machine learning. These books will help you take your skills to the next level and tackle more complex problems.

    Time Series Analysis

    Time series analysis is a crucial tool for quants, allowing them to model and forecast financial data that evolves over time. "Time Series Analysis" by James Douglas Hamilton is often cited as the go-to resource for this topic. Hamilton's book is known for its rigor and depth, covering a wide range of models and techniques, including ARMA, ARIMA, and state-space models. It's a challenging read, but it provides an unparalleled understanding of time series analysis. For a more practical approach, consider "Analysis of Financial Time Series" by Ruey S. Tsay. Tsay's book focuses on the application of time series methods to financial data, with numerous examples and case studies. It covers topics such as volatility modeling, cointegration, and high-frequency data analysis. Another valuable resource is "Time Series: Theory and Methods" by Peter J. Brockwell and Richard A. Davis. This book provides a comprehensive and mathematically rigorous treatment of time series analysis, covering both theory and applications. With a strong understanding of time series analysis, you'll be able to build sophisticated models for forecasting asset prices, managing risk, and developing trading strategies. Remember, mastering time series analysis is essential for navigating the complexities of financial markets.

    Stochastic Calculus

    Stochastic calculus is the mathematical framework for modeling random processes that evolve over time. It's an essential tool for pricing derivatives, modeling interest rates, and managing risk. A classic book in this area is "Stochastic Calculus for Finance I: The Binomial Asset Pricing Model" by Steven Shreve. This book provides a rigorous and accessible introduction to stochastic calculus, starting with the binomial asset pricing model and gradually building up to more advanced topics. Shreve's clear explanations and numerous examples make it an excellent choice for beginners. Another popular choice is "Financial Calculus: An Introduction to Derivative Pricing" by Martin Baxter and Andrew Rennie. This book provides a more intuitive approach to stochastic calculus, focusing on the practical applications of the theory. It covers topics such as Black-Scholes model, hedging strategies, and exotic options. For a more advanced treatment, consider "Brownian Motion and Stochastic Calculus" by Ioannis Karatzas and Steven E. Shreve. This book provides a rigorous and comprehensive treatment of Brownian motion and stochastic calculus, covering both theory and applications. With a strong understanding of stochastic calculus, you'll be able to price complex derivatives, model financial markets, and manage risk effectively. Remember, mastering stochastic calculus is essential for anyone working with derivatives or other complex financial instruments.

    Machine Learning in Finance

    Machine learning is rapidly transforming the finance industry, with applications ranging from fraud detection to algorithmic trading. "Machine Learning for Asset Management: New Predictive Models for Investment Decisions" by Marcos Lopez de Prado is a great resource that bridges the gap between machine learning and finance, providing practical guidance on how to apply machine learning techniques to asset management. It covers topics such as feature engineering, model selection, and backtesting. Another excellent book is "Hands-On Machine Learning with Scikit-Learn, Keras & TensorFlow" by Aurélien Géron. While not specifically focused on finance, this book provides a comprehensive introduction to machine learning, covering a wide range of algorithms and techniques. Its hands-on approach and numerous examples make it an excellent choice for those looking to quickly get up to speed with machine learning. Also, look at "Advances in Financial Machine Learning" also by Marcos Lopez de Prado; is the more advanced approach to the topic. With a solid understanding of machine learning, you'll be able to build more accurate predictive models, automate trading strategies, and gain a competitive edge in the financial markets. Remember, machine learning is a powerful tool that can help you unlock new insights and opportunities in finance.

    Staying Current: Journals and Online Resources

    The world of quant finance is constantly evolving, so it's important to stay current with the latest research and developments. In addition to books, there are several journals and online resources that can help you stay informed. Academic journals like the "Journal of Financial Economics," "The Journal of Finance," and "The Review of Financial Studies" publish cutting-edge research on a wide range of topics in finance. These journals are a great way to stay up-to-date on the latest theoretical developments. Online resources like arXiv, SSRN, and QuantLib provide access to pre-prints, working papers, and open-source software, allowing you to stay on the forefront of innovation. Additionally, websites like Wilmott.com and QuantNet offer forums, articles, and other resources for quants. Subscribing to relevant blogs and newsletters can also help you stay informed about the latest trends and developments. Remember, continuous learning is essential for success in the dynamic world of quant finance. So, always be curious, always be learning, and always be pushing the boundaries of what's possible.